James Janeway [1]

an English divine, was born in Hertfordshire, and educated at Christ Church, Oxford. In 1652 he left the State Church and set up a dissenting congregation (Presbyterian) at Rotherhithe. He died in 1674. Besides a life of his brother John (q.v.) and his sermons, he published The Saint's Encouragement (1675, 8vo): Token for Children (1676, 8vo, and often): Heaven upon Earth (1677, 8vo).
